On April 3, the American Airlines Center was alive with energy as students, staff, and families from across Ignite campuses came together for a day of teamwork, school pride, and community connection. The event tipped off with a half-court tournament, where student teams from each campus competed for the title of Ignite Campus Champion. The excitement carried into a fan-favorite finale as the winning team faced off against Ignite staff in an action-packed Teacher vs. Student showdown.

The celebration continued into the evening, with attendees staying to watch the Dallas Mavericks take on the Orlando Magic, turning the day into a full showcase of basketball and community spirit.

“This event truly captured what Ignite is all about: connection, opportunity, and creating memorable experiences for our scholars,” said Ronald Shepard, School Operations Manager for Ignite Community Schools. “We are grateful for this partnership with the Mavericks and the generosity they have shown Ignite Community Schools and our families.”
